DVS Simplified DaaS
Deliver secure, full-featured virtual desktops — minus infrastructure cost — and reduce the complexity of deploying virtual desktop infrastructure (VDI) with cloud-based, Dell desktop as a service (DaaS).

With Dell DaaS, you manage your virtual desktops (user profiles, operating system and applications) with a self-service portal and Dell manages your VDI — including data center hardware and facilities, VDI software and security — as a monthly subscription service. Users can connect to full-featured virtual desktops from anywhere, at anytime, using any device — but those virtual desktop resources never leave the secure cloud.

Dell DaaS removes the infrastructure management complexity of VDI with a Dell-hosted virtual desktop service. Choose from:
  • DaaS Standard (2GB RAM and 20GB storage, and PCoIP or remote desktop protocol (RDP)) includes Microsoft Windows Server operating system for file and print services
  • DaaS Professional (4GB RAM and 20GB storage, and PCoIP protocol)

Dell DaaS Made Easier extends Dell DaaS to include desktop virtualization, cloud services, endpoints and financing in one offer. You can manage your DaaS desktops and servers, users and images from a secure enterprise portal. The Dell DaaS Made Easier offer includes:
  • DaaS Startup. To help ensure optimal performance, Dell experts set up your environment, including:
    • DaaS infrastructure and network configuration
    • A virtual private network (VPN) to protect your Active Directory communication to the DaaS platform
    • Onboarding to quickly set up and integrate DaaS into your environment
  • Microsoft Windows VDA Licenses. Virtual Desktop Access (VDA) licenses provide the remote Microsoft Windows access thin clients and mobile devices need.
  • Microsoft Client Access Licenses: Client access licenses enable users to access Microsoft Windows Server services, such as file and print.
  • Microsoft Office (optional): Add popular MS Office licenses to the offer and leverage Dell negotiated prices.
  • Wyse Device Manager (WDM) (optional): Rack and manage your Wyse devices with WDM.
  • Endpoints: Choose from a variety of Dell Wyse thin clients that includes the Linux-based, high-performance D50D with dual-core AMD™ processor.

Qualified customers can lease thin clients and licenses for the Dell DaaS solution from Dell Financial Services (DFS) or Dell Business Credit.

Simplify management

Provision, activate and manage your virtual desktops from a central web portal. With DVS Simplified DaaS, you don’t have to manage, secure or maintain your virtual desktop infrastructure — Dell does that for you.

Rapidly scale your virtual desktop environment

Rapidly scale the number of desktops up or down, as needed. With cloud-based DVS Simplified DaaS, you deploy additional virtual desktops from a central management console, and Dell manages the logistics of scaling capacity.
 

Secure your virtual desktops

  • Secure your desktops with a private network connection that uses your Active Directory to authenticate user access. With this configuration, the virtual desktop environment looks like an extension of your IT environment even though it’s running in remote data center
  • Keep your data safe by storing it in your secure data center or in a Dell facility. Protect data transfer with secure virtual private network (VPN) connections

Save money

  • Lower your up-front costs with a predictable monthly subscription. This enables you to scale your infrastructure based on fluctuating business demands without the cost of IT management.
  • Save on space, power, as well as the cost of managing a data center.
  • Spend less time managing corporate desktops and more time on strategic projects.

Dell offers the following optional services to support you at every step — from deployment to ownership:

  • Remote Advisory Services — Remotely import images, create templates, assign users and configure DVS Simplified DaaS with guidance throughout the process from Dell experts.
  • Jump-Start Training — Train IT administrators to master account setup, configuration and administration activities.
  • Blueprint Assessment — Work with Dell experts to inventory your hardware and software, analyze your current IT environment and design your optimal desktop virtualization solution.
  • Network Optimization — Optimize performance and availability with a comprehensive assessment of your network. This includes network and application measurements, analysis and performance optimization, and detailed recommendations.
  • Image Creation — Work with Dell experts to convert your physical desktop image into an optimized virtual image you can deploy to your users.
  • Application Packaging Services — Get your applications and settings converted into a package that can be installed remotely, without physical intervention.
